Реклама:

В конце гл. 1 автор выразил надежду на то, что сумеет разделить с читателями свой восторг от первого знакомства с методикой Джексона конструирования программ. Автор полагает, что эта надежда оправдалась!

Литература

1. Jackson А., System Development, Englewood Cliffs NJ, Prentice-Hall, 1983.

2. Böhm С, Jacopini G.. Nuove Techniche di Programma-zione Semplificanti la Sintesi di Macchine Universale di Turing, Rend. Асе. Naz. Lincei., 8, No. З? pp. 913- 922 (June, 1962).

3. Dijkstra w., Programming Considered as a Human Activity, Proceedings of the 1965 IFIP Congress. Amsterdam, The Netherlands: North Holland Publishing, dd 213-17 (1965). ™' Dijkstra w., Go To Statement Considered Harmful. Communications of the ACM, 11, No. 3, pp. 147-4Й (March, 1968).

4. King D., Current Practices in Software Development» NewYork, Yourdon Press, 1984.

5. Jackson A., Principles of Programm Design, London, Academic Press, 197b.

6. Orr Т., Structered Systems Development, NewYork, Yourdon Press, 1977.

7. Martin J., Computer Database Organization, Englewood Cliffs, NJ, Prentice-Hall, 197b. [Имеется перевод: Мартин Дж. Организация баз данных в вычислительных системах. - М. : Мир, 1980. ]

8. Warnier J-D., Logical Construction of Programs, Leiden, The Netherlands, H.E. Stenfert Kroese BV, 1974.

9. Yourdon Ed., Managing the System of Life Cycle: A Software Development Methodology Overview, NewYork, Yourdon Press, 1982.

10. GaneC, Sarson T., Structured Systems Analysis: Tools and Techniques, Englewood Cliffs, NJ, Prentice-Hall, 1979.

11. Yourdon E., Constantine L.L., Structured Design: Fundamentals of a Discipline of Computer Programming and System Design, 2nd edition, NewYork, Yourdon Press, 1978.

12. King M.J., Pardoe J.P., Program Design Using JSP: A Practical Introduction, NewYork, Halstea Press, 1985.

13. Ingevaldsson L., JSP - A Practical Method of Program Design, Bromley, England, Chartwel1-Brati, 1985.

14. Sanden B., Systems Programming with JSP, Bromley, England, Chartwel1-Bratt, 1985.

15. Sanden В., Systems Programming with JSP: Example ~ A VDU Controller, Communications of the ACM, 28, No. 10 (October 1985).

Оглавление

Предисловие редактора перевода........................5

Предисловие...........................................6

Предисловие автора....................................7

Глава 1. Что такое конструирование программ?..........9

1.1 Что делают программы?............................9

1.2 Типы программного обеспечения...................10

1. 3 Построение программы............................13

1.4 Подход Джексона к конструированию...............16

1.5 Назначение этой книги...........................18

Глава 2. Основы методики Джексона....................20

2.1 Источники методики Джексона.....................20

2. 2 Основные конструкции построения структур данных. 22

2. 3 Как строить структуры данных....................28

2. 4 Структуры данных с точки зрения наблюдателя.....31


⇐ Предыдущая страница| |Следующая страница ⇒